A Survey of Morant Keys.
- Author: RORIE, Lieutenant John James
- Publication place: London
- Publisher: Capt Hurd RN Hydrographic Officer to the Admiralty
- Publication date: 4th June 1814.
- Physical description: Engraved chart.
- Dimensions: 290 by 205mm. (11.5 by 8 inches).
- Inventory reference: 11672
Notes
Rare Admiralty chart of Morant Cays, Jamaica.
The survey was carried out by John James Rorie of the Royal Navy.
John Walker, founding member of the Royal Geographic Society, was a leading mapmaker and engraver working in London in the first half of the nineteenth century. He is known to have produced numerous charts for James Horsburgh and the Admiralty.
